BTS Jimin Ranked No. 1 in Japan's 'Most Popular K-pop Male Idol for August' for 18 Consecutive Months

BTS member Jimin has solidified his status as the "King of K-pop" by winning first place in a popular vote in Japan for 18 consecutive months.


Jimin topped the monthly survey conducted by the Japanese Hallyu media outlet Danmee, which focuses on the "No. 1 Most Popular K-pop Male Idol" theme. The August survey, which ran from August 20 to August 27, 2024, saw Jimin secure first place with 2,852 votes, accounting for 45.78% of the total 6,230 votes. This marks his record-breaking 18-month winning streak.


Danmee highlighted Jimin's recent activities, noting that he released his second solo album MUSE on July 19, with the title track "WHO" continuing to perform well on the UK Official Singles Chart and the US Billboard Hot 100. This survey is conducted to capture the live opinions of Japanese K-pop fans, allowing each person to vote only once for a single idol, ensuring fairness in the voting process. Danmee selects 27 currently prominent K-pop male idols based on domestic activity indices, brand reputation, monthly mentions on X (formerly Twitter), and page views of related Danmee articles.


Meanwhile, Jimin's song WHO ranked 52nd on the Billboard Japan Hot 100 chart as of September 11, remaining on the chart for eight consecutive weeks. On the same day, it also ranked No. 1 on Spotify Japan's Daily Top Songs chart. Jimin became the first Korean soloist to achieve this feat, holding the top spot for a total of 20 days, further showcasing the overwhelming love and support from Japanese fans.
